## Artifact Signing — Stockwise Restock Planner

The Stockwise planner computes nightly restock routes for the Harmon vending fleet and ships the schedule as a signed bundle. Field devices refuse unsigned bundles, so a signing failure means machines run yesterday's plan — degraded, not down. If the overnight job pages you, check the signer service first, then re-run the bundle step manually. Verification on devices uses the public half of the release key below.

rollout seal: bky4_x7Gc

Runbook: hunting leaked file descriptors in the Copperline ingest daemon. Check open FD counts per worker with the stats endpoint; anything above 2,000 is suspect. Restarting workers masks the leak, so capture an lsof snapshot first and attach it to the incident channel. When escalating, include the host name and the build token shown just below.

pipeline stamp: htk9_ce63042d9

// Heads up, support folks: this constant pins the Larkspool shared
// component library version used across all Dunmere apps. If a customer
// reports mismatched button styles or broken modals, check whether their
// app was built against an older pin. Bump only via the release train,
// never ad hoc. The currently shipped build token is noted just below.

pipeline stamp: htk31_f769b577b3028a4e9958e5bb8d1259a